Rampage starring Dwayne 'The Rock' Johnson was originally scheduled to be stampeding in North American cinemas on April 20th, 2018.

However thanks to a last minute change from Avengers: Infinity War, Warner Bros has had to alter the release date for the video game film.

As reported by The Hollywood Reporter, the new release date for Rampage is now April 13th, 2018 which is a week earlier than before.

Warner Bros did this in order to be two weeks away from the April 27th, 2018 release date of Avengers: Infinity War.

Sources say the producers of Rampage wanted to keep the two week gap between the two movies since Infinity War is expected to obliterate all of the competition when it comes out.

This change means Steven Spielberg's 'Ready Player One' now only has two weeks of free competition when it hits on March 30th, 2018.

Anyway, this is not the first time Disney has caused Warner Bros to back away from a certain release date.

May 6th, 2016 was the original release date for Batman v Superman: Dawn of Justice, but Disney decided to snag it for Captain America: Civil War.

Batman v Superman: Dawn of Justice was forced to come out in late March instead. Anyway, I'm glad Rampage and Infinity War have been broken apart because it gives a chance for both movies to shine.
